Expanding Geothermal Access ‌Beyond Conventional ⁢Limits

Traditional geothermal systems are typically restricted to zones where significant heat is⁣ near the Earth’s crust—largely because these areas coincide with tectonic plate boundaries characterized ⁣by thinner crusts and volcanic activity that generates thermal energy. Emerging technologies⁢ aim to revolutionize this by enabling geothermal exploitation in nearly any location.

Diving Deeper for Enhanced ⁤Energy ‍Extraction

The concept revolves around deeper drilling capabilities ⁢that target superhot rocks (SHR), where temperatures exceed 374 degrees ⁢Celsius; such extreme ​conditions allow extraction of larger quantities of energy more efficiently compared to​ conventional sources.

Safeguarding against operational risks involves comprehensive site analysis concerning subsurface features including geological formations, fault lines’ locations, heat⁤ flow dynamics, and various heat sources. As pointed out by Saltiel, successful geothermal project implementation hinges​ on detailed evaluations regarding temperature profiles ‍over time as fluids circulate within these complex⁢ geological systems.
